aredd33 wrote: ↑November 30th, 2021, 4:55 pmDie hard Sooner fan, and all for Riley taking the USC Job based on a combo of reasons. OU needed the SEC to not die a slow death in Big 12 due to NIL, recruiting and tv $. What does that do pressure wise for LR who was supposed to win it this year and things didn’t fall in line with O’Line/ QB and D was solid but inconsistent. Great ability to recruit CA talent to OU. $ is a push due to taxes and cost of living, BUT media capital of the world and when USC is good, they are a force in media. He can own PAC 12 and CA and be front runner for any NFL job after if he wants it. Scared of SEC ? - a lot of Okies are saying it, but from a pure “agent” perspective - I am advising him to take it. His age, personality, aura, style/charisma is perfect for USC. That aside - his agent was talking to them day 1 of opening and the LSU job was in play but more of smoke screen - mentally he has been gone since bye week and we all knew something was off - he had never lost a game in November and it showed he wasn’t 100% in to it at Baylor. Now OU is getting gutted of all his 23 and most 22 recruits and scrambling. My opinion is we have been pretty soft and not physical under Riley - so losing recruits and starting over with a fresh base will take some time but might actually be better long run depending on staff we get.
